Despite some hand wringing, the San Jose City Council voted unanimously Tuesday, with Vice Mayor Pam Foley absent, to approve a new, expanded contract with the firm to provide the technologies to the San Jose Police Department. The city extended the existing contract, portions of which were set to expire in December, through June 2031. The decision also increases the city's payments to Axon over a five-year period beginning July 2026 by about $9.3 million to a total estimated cost of $17.4 million.
Newcastle United midfielder Sandro Tonali is effectively contracted to the club until 2030 after it was revealed the midfielder signed an extension during his 10-month suspension for gambling offences. Tonali joined Newcastle from AC Milan in July 2023 on a five-year contract, but saw his first season prematurely ended when his ban was handed down in October. According to multiple reports, the Italy international then approached the club about taking a pay cut.

Denver Nuggets guard Christian Braun has agreed to a five-year, $125 million rookie contract extension with the franchise, agent Bill Duffy of WME Basketball told ESPN on Monday. Braun, the No. 21 pick in the 2022 NBA draft, has been a developmental find and success for the Nuggets brass. The Nuggets' top executives, Ben Tenzer and Jon Wallace, made it a priority to negotiate a new long-term deal to lock in Braun as part of the franchise's core moving forward.

Barcelona have confirmed that young prospect Landry Farré has signed a new contract with the club until 2028. The 18-year-old is widely considered to be one of the best defenders coming through the ranks at present and has now committed his future to the Catalan giants. "FC Barcelona and player Landry Farré have reached an agreement to extend the defender's contract for two more seasons, so he will remain linked to the Club until June 30, 2028."

The Tigers and manager AJ Hinch quietly agreed to a long-term contract extension during the 2025 season, president of baseball operations Scott Harris announced today at his end-of-season press conference ( video link). Harris and Hinch did not specify the length of the contract, but Hinch ostensibly is now signed through at least 2027. Harris effused praise for Hinch, calling him one of the best managers in the sport and saying he hopes to continue working with him "as long as I can possibly work with him."
